Be aware - it is common for rental agreements to have language about advance notice when you are leaving, specific moving dates (mostly in ZH), and requirements for finding a replacement tenant. These aren't "catches" per se, but normal contract clauses that have caused frustration for many renters. Make sure you read and understand any contract you sign, and if you don't understand have someone translate for you. Not understanding what you signed is not a valid excuse for breaking a contract. This goes for rental agreements, phone, insurance, TV, gym memberships, etc.
Hi, as far as I am aware immoscout and homegate are only listing websites and not really agents. Agents will charge commission only if you explicitly hire an agent to help find you an apartment. People put the details in their adverts if the apartment has been advertised by the owner or as is very popular here by an agency hired by the owner. Getting only a 6 month contract will be difficult unless you manage to find somebody would wants to sublet for that time. Plus will come the added work of furnishing it.
If you are here only for 6 months I would recommend going in for a furnished or serviced apartment. You can also try at homegate and immoscout for these.
